Definition of HTTP/2 Protocol_Error
HTTP/2 Protocol_Error refers specifically to issues that arise during communication within the HTTP/2 framework. This error occurs when the protocol fails to follow established rules, leading to interrupted connections or broken data streams. It’s like a miscommunication between two friends who can’t quite grasp each other’s language.
Common Causes of HTTP/2 Protocol_Error
Several reasons often trigger HTTP/2 Protocol_Error.
- Improper implementation: If developers don’t fully comply with the HTTP/2 specifications, errors creep in.
- Network interruptions: Temporary disruptions in internet connections can cause the protocol to throw up its hands in frustration.
- Malformed frames: Sending data in a way that doesn’t align with protocol expectations results in a Protocol_Error. For instance, a frame without the necessary header information.
- Server configuration glitches: Incorrectly set up servers can struggle to manage requests like they should.
- Client-server handshake errors: If the client’s attempt to establish a secure connection with the server stumbles, errors will occur.

Tools for Detection
Tools for detecting HTTP/2 Protocol_Error can simplify your analysis. Here are a few reliable ones:
- Browser Developer Tools: Most modern browsers come with built-in options to view network activity. You can check HTTP responses, see error codes, and inspect requests.
- cURL: This command-line tool lets you test HTTP requests, viewing the responses directly. You get clear, raw data.
- Wireshark: This network protocol analyzer captures packets and presents them in detail. A little complex but valuable for serious issues.
- HTTP/2 Testing Tools: Online platforms like https://tools.keycdn.com/http2-test help you identify if HTTP/2 is functioning as expected.

Immediate Solutions
First, restart your network router. Often, a simple reset clears up temporary glitches.
Next, check server configurations. Ensure all settings align with HTTP/2 requirements. Misconfigurations can easily trigger errors.
Additionally, validate HTTP/2 settings in your server’s SSL certificates. Incorrect configurations here lead to handshake failures.
Inspect the website’s code for malformed frames. These frames disrupt proper communication, causing big problems.
You can use browser developer tools to evaluate ongoing connections. This will show you which requests fail and why.
